[0001] This utility model relates to a panel, and more particularly to a circular tone zither panel. Background Technology
[0002] Because the soundboard of a framed zither is pieced together and relatively thin, it is prone to cracking after prolonged use, affecting the zither's usability and shortening its lifespan. In contrast, a carved zither is supported by a single piece of board, resulting in a one-piece molded structure with high structural strength and a long lifespan, making it popular with consumers. However, existing carved zithers suffer from insufficient reverberation and excessively long looping sounds, significantly reducing the user experience. Utility Model Content
[0003] This invention aims to at least partially solve one of the technical problems in the related art. To this end, this invention proposes a circular tone zither panel.
[0004] The technical solution adopted by this utility model to solve its technical problem is: a circulating sound zither panel, including a panel body, wherein the panel body is an integrally formed arc-shaped plate;
[0005] The bottom surface of the panel body, between the front and rear Yue Shan, is provided with a first echo zone, a second echo zone, and a third echo zone in sequence.
[0006] The first reverberation zone includes multiple wave-shaped reverberation grooves arranged horizontally in sequence, the second reverberation zone includes multiple vertically arranged U-shaped reverberation grooves, and the third reverberation zone includes multiple wave-shaped reverberation grooves arranged horizontally in sequence.
[0007] In a preferred embodiment of this utility model, the length of the first reverberation zone is 28-32cm, the length of the second reverberation zone is 58-62cm, and the length of the third reverberation zone is 38-42cm.
[0008] In a preferred embodiment of this utility model, the length of the first reverberation zone is 30cm, the length of the second reverberation zone is 60cm, and the length of the third reverberation zone is 40cm.
[0009] In a preferred embodiment of this utility model, the width of the wavy echo groove is 5-7mm.
[0010] In a preferred embodiment of this utility model, the width of the U-shaped echo groove is 6-8mm.
[0011] The beneficial effects of this utility model are: This utility model adopts a structure that combines a wave-shaped sustain groove and a U-shaped sustain groove to achieve the desired charm and sustain when playing the zither, while the tone is clean and not messy, which greatly improves the performance effect and enhances the user experience. [0019] like Figures 1 to 4 The diagram shows a circular sound zither panel, including a panel body 1, which is an integrally formed arc-shaped plate, making the zither panel body 1 a whole and extending its service life.
[0020] The bottom surface of the panel body 1, between the front and rear Yue Shan, is provided with a first echo zone 11, a second echo zone 12 and a third echo zone 13 in sequence;
[0021] The first reverberation zone 11 includes a plurality of wave-shaped reverberation grooves 2 arranged horizontally in sequence, the second reverberation zone 12 includes a plurality of vertically arranged U-shaped reverberation grooves 3, and the third reverberation zone 13 includes a plurality of wave-shaped reverberation grooves 2 arranged horizontally in sequence.
[0022] This invention employs a structure combining a wave-shaped sustain groove 2 and a U-shaped sustain groove 3. Compared to situations where only a wave-shaped sustain groove 2 is used, resulting in excessively long resonant notes during guzheng performance, causing interference and a chaotic sound between the sustain and subsequent notes, or where only a U-shaped sustain groove 3 is used, leading to insufficient sustain and a lack of resonant resonance, this invention utilizes a structure where wave-shaped sustain groove 2, U-shaped sustain groove 3, and wave-shaped sustain groove 2 are sequentially arranged on the bottom surface of the panel body 1, corresponding to the front and rear bridges. Through the coordinated arrangement of these three slots, the desired resonance and sustain are achieved during guzheng performance, while maintaining a clean and uncluttered tone, significantly improving the performance effect and enhancing the user experience.
[0023] In a preferred embodiment, the first reverberation zone 11 in this application has a length of 28-32cm, the second reverberation zone 12 has a length of 58-62cm, and the third reverberation zone 13 has a length of 38-42cm; more specifically, the first reverberation zone 11 has a length of 30cm, the second reverberation zone 12 has a length of 60cm, and the third reverberation zone 13 has a length of 40cm. The length ratios of these three reverberation zones achieve the best desired resonance and sustain during performance, while also resulting in a clean and unmixed tone.
[0024] In a preferred embodiment, the width of the wavy echo groove 2 in this application is 5-7mm. The width of the U-shaped echo groove 3 is 6-8mm. More specifically, the width of the wavy echo groove 2 is 6mm, and the width of the U-shaped echo groove 3 is 7mm. The wavy echo groove 2 and U-shaped echo groove 3 with the above-mentioned widths can achieve the best echo quality, and the repetitive sound is moderate, which will not interfere with the subsequent playing, resulting in a clean and uncluttered tone, while having the best echo quality required for playing the zither, thus improving the user experience.
